Introduction – Pieter-Jan Huyghe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service...

Post on 30-Dec-2015

216 views 1 download

Tags:

Transcript of Introduction – Pieter-Jan Huyghe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service...

Introduction –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 1

The aging population is a 21st century problem

- The percentage of people over 65 rises yearly- Costs continue to rise

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 2

The aging population is a 21st century problem Example: Warmhof

Maldegem

- 124 rooms- 200 inhabitants- Built in 2007- Cost: 20 mio

Not all inhabitants need constant monitoring and care…

Introduction –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 3

Introducing the smart home

Objective:- Cut costs- Create space

Solution:- Provide a safe environment- Keep people at home- Patient/worker ratio

Introduction –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 4

Introducing the smart home

Basic smart home components:- Sensors- Communication system- Data processing unit

Introduction – Pieter-Jan Huyghe

Introduction

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 5

Hier komt vincent

Rules

Overview –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 6

SensorsData

acquisitionReasoner Output

Data acquisition –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 7

Data acquisition:- Multiple sensors: polling based- Single sensor queries are supported- N3 format

Example:

Rules

SensorsData

acquisitionReasoner Output

Reasoner –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 8

Reasoning module:- Gathers all the data- Combines data with rules- Deduces new facts

Rules

SensorsData

acquisitionReasoner Output

Reasoner –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 9

Reasoning module is very important- Has to be fast- Has to be reliable- Low resource consumption is a plus

Choosing the right reasoner is key

Rules

SensorsData

acquisitionReasoner Output

Reasoner –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 10

Choosing the right reasoner:Jena EYE

User License Open source Open source

Last updated 2010-12 2012-5

Install Size 23.3 Mb 13.9 Mb

Type of reasoning

Forward, backward or hybrid

Backward-forward-backward

Ease of use Complex Easy

Execution speed

Moderate Fast

Accuracy High HighRules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 11

Rules:- Determine how well the reasoner works- Bind values to a fact or action- Combine facts logically- Have to be easy to maintain and read

Rules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 12

Basic rule example:

Rules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 13

Multi-sensor:

Rules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 14

Combine facts:

Rules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 15

Combine facts to detect unusual patient behavior:

Rules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 16

Combine facts to detect unusual patient behavior:

Rules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 17

Influence sensor behavior:

Rules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 18

Sensor malfunction reporting:- Value collections

Rules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 19

Sensor malfunction reporting:- Value collections- Value pairs

Ambient Light: 11%

Bed Pressure: 85%

Location: bed

Camera Light: 89% Rules

SensorsData

acquisitionReasoner Output

Rules –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 20

Sensor malfunction reporting:- Value collections- Value pairs

Ambient Light: 11%

Bed Pressure: 85%

Location: bed

Camera Light: 89%

Person is sleeping

Rules

SensorsData

acquisitionReasoner Output

Output –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 21

Key functions:-Report, detect and alert

This data can be passed on in many different ways.

Rules

SensorsData

acquisitionReasoner Output

Future work – Pieter-Jan Huyghe

Vincent Haerinck, Henry Houdmont, Pieter-Jan Huyghe- Service oriented architecture for multi-sensor surveillance in smart homes - 2011-2012 - 22

Future work:- Implement machine learning